Position Summary
Ultra Maritime is seeking a motivated Mechanical Engineer I to join our Engineering team. This entry-level position is ideal for recent graduates or early-career engineers who are eager to apply their mechanical engineering knowledge while contributing to the design, development, testing, and production of advanced defense systems.Working under the guidance of experienced engineers, the Mechanical Engineer I will support engineering projects by designing mechanical components, conducting engineering analyses, performing prototype testing, and assisting with product development from concept through production.
Job Description
Key Responsibilities
- Apply mechanical engineering principles to support project objectives while meeting customer cost, schedule, and quality requirements.
- Design, analyze, and maintain mechanical components and assemblies in accordance with engineering requirements and applicable standards.
- Create and maintain engineering documentation including drawings, Bills of Materials (BOMs), specifications, and engineering change documentation.
- Develop 3D CAD models, detailed drawings, and engineering designs for new and existing products.
- Assist with prototype fabrication, assembly, integration, and testing.
- Conduct prototype and qualification testing to evaluate product performance, reliability, and safety.
- Collect, analyze, and document test data; recommend design improvements based on results.
- Support root cause investigations and corrective actions for product or manufacturing issues.
- Collaborate with Manufacturing, Quality, Supply Chain, Systems, Electrical, and Configuration Management teams throughout the product lifecycle.
- Participate in design reviews, peer reviews, and technical meetings.
- Support manufacturing by resolving production issues and implementing engineering improvements.
- Travel to customer sites, suppliers, or test facilities as required (up to 10%).
Required Qualifications
- Bachelor of Science degree in Mechanical Engineering or a related engineering discipline.
- 0+ years of professional engineering experience or completion of a recognized engineering apprenticeship or internship.
- Fundamental understanding of mechanical design principles and engineering analysis.
- Strong analytical, problem-solving, and organizational skills.
- Excellent written and verbal communication skills.
- Ability to work effectively in a collaborative, multidisciplinary team environment.
- Experience with 3D CAD software such as:
- SolidWorks
- Autodesk Inventor
- Creo
- U.S. Citizenship required with the ability to obtain and maintain a U.S. Government Security Clearance.
Preferred Qualifications
- Knowledge of common manufacturing processes including machining, sheet metal fabrication, molding, welding, or additive manufacturing.
- Internship, co-op, or university project experience involving mechanical design or testing.
- Exposure to engineering documentation, prototype development, and laboratory testing.
